Table 3.

Semi-quantitative inhibition of biofilm formation for bacterial and yeast pathogens non-treated and treated with ZnCexFe2−xO4; X = 0.06.

Bacterial and Yeast Strains O.D. of Crystal Violet Stain at 570.0 nm Inhibition %
Control ZnCexFe2−xO4; X = 0.06 (10.0 µg/mL)
Staphylococcus aureus 1.058 e ± 0.0080 0.020 a ± 0.0021 92.73%
Pseudomonas aeruginosa 0.945 d ± 0.0062 0.241 c ± 0.0047 78.83%
Escherichia coli 0.877 b ± 0.0070 0.298 c ± 0.0053 75.27%
Klebsiella pneumoniae 0.998 d ± 0.0025 0.388 d ± 0.0062 61.24%
Proteus vulgaris 0.899 c ± 0.0046 0.444 e ± 0.0036 56.29%
Salmonella typhi 1.222 f ± 0.0070 0.831 a ± 0.0053 26.18%
Proteus mirabilis 0.989 d ± 0.0062 0.211 c ± 0.0047 79.54%
Candida albicans 0.999 d ± 0.0080 0.099 b ± 0.0021 90.18%
Candida tropicalis 0.557 a ± 0.0080 0.451 e ± 0.0021 34.16%
LSD 0.01767 0.01267 ------------

Values are means ± SD (n = 3). Data within the groups were analysed using one-way analysis of variance (ANOVA) followed by a,b,c,d,e,f Duncan’s multiple range test (DMRT) and LSD = least significant difference.
